I'm trying to run this in Command Prompt, by typing regsvr32 3ivxDSMediaSplitter.ax, but it's not working. I'm doing this because I don't want the entire 3ivx package, just an mp4 splitter. Any advice?

opsis81
16th February 2005, 14:23
3ivxDSMediaSplitter.ax requires OpenQuicktimeLib.dll
Do you have it in the same folder with 3ivxDSMediaSplitter.ax or in your system directory?

bond
16th February 2005, 16:01
Originally posted by Elias
Like I said, I don't have 3ivx installed. You mean that I should've done this before uninstalling and then register the 3ivxsplitter? 1) register the 3ivx splitter (no need to install 3ivx)
2) open the 3ivx splitter in graphedit
3) open the 3ivx splitter settings
4) tick the "allow unsupported decoders" option in the 3ivx splitter

opsis81
17th February 2005, 03:13
You don't need Nero Splitter Elias.
NeSplitter is used for mpeg files not for mp4 files.You need Nero Digital Parser (NDParser.ax)
Nero Digital Parser works without having Nero installed.
I never had Nero installed to my laptop but NDParser and ffdshow work fine there.
Nero Video Decoder (NeVideo.ax) and Nero Digital Audio Decoder (NeAudio.ax) don't work without having Nero installed.
There's nothing wrong with your computer,Nero filters will not reboot your PC,you don't need to register,unregister or change any merit.
All you need is NDParser.ax (I think the latest version is 2.0.2.37)
and latest ffdshow.
If you want to use Nero Digital Parser for mov files too you will also need Nero QuickTime(tm) Decoder Wrapper also.It's a filter named as NeQTDec.ax nd its latest version is 1.0.0.4.This filter will also work without having Nero installed.
